    AAC offers undergraduate degrees in Fine Arts, Communication Arts, and Art History, as well as a Master's degree in Art Education (MAAE) and an Associate's degree in Graphic Design. The Academy's nondegree Community Education programs serve thousands of children and adults each year.

    We may be small, but our commitment is big. It's the same commitment our students make to themselves: to make the best art they can. The Art Academy of Cincinnati has kept that commitment since 1869, building a rich tradition of innovation and excellence in the visual arts.

    The Art Academy is one of the smallest four-year art colleges in the country, and that's one of our greatest strengths: It means our students really get to be themselves. They receive individualized attention from faculty, the freedom to develop their personal vision, and a unique opportunity to carve out their identity.
